Team News
Wolves
Wolves captain and star midfielder Ruben Neves picked up his 10th yellow card of the season against Nottingham Forest and will now serve a two-match suspension, while defender Jonny Castro will serve the second of his three-match ban this weekend.

Sasa Kalajdzic, Chiquinho (both knee) and Hwang Hee-chan (unspecified) all remain in the treatment room with injuries, but left-back Hugo Bueno recovered from a minor hamstring problem to feature as a substitute last time out and will look to force his way back into the first XI against Chelsea.

After coming off the bench to score last weekend, top scorer Podence – who has netted six times this season – could replace either Joao Moutinho or Mario Lemina in the starting lineup, while former Chelsea striker Diego Costa will battle with Raul Jimenez for a place up front.
Wolverhampton Wanderers possible starting lineup:
Sa; Semedo, Dawson, Kilman, Bueno; Lemina, Neves, Nunes; A. Traore, Jimenez, Podence

Chelsea
As for Chelsea, Cesar Azpilicueta, Thiago Silva and Armando Broja are all nursing knee injuries, while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ang is doubtful with a back problem.

Lampard has promised to give everyone in his first-team squad a "clean slate", while he has also labelled Mason Mount a "huge player" for the Blues, and the midfielder could be recalled to centre-midfield to start alongside Enzo Fernandez and N'Golo Kante.

A four-man defence was predominantly used by Lampard during his first stint as Chelsea boss and the same set-up could be deployed on Saturday, with Wesley Fofana, Kalidou Koulibaly and Benoit Badiashile battling to start at centre-back, while Reece James and Ben Chilwell are expected to begin at full-back.

Mykhaylo Mudryk, Raheem Sterling, Noni Madueke and Christian Pulisic, who all began as substitutes against Liverpool, will compete for a place on either flank, and a start for two of these wingers could see either Kai Havertz and Joao Felix drop out of the first XI.
Chelsea possible starting lineup:
Kepa; James, W. Fofana, Badiashile, Chilwell; Kante, Fernandez, Mount; Madueke, Havertz, Sterling
